Ordinals
beta
Sat 1688977993943290
decimal
511182.493943290
degree
0°91182′1134″493943290‴
percentile
80.42752360957937%
name
bwrffxxjmpr
cycle
0
epoch
2
period
253
block
511182
offset
493943290
timestamp
2018-02-27 17:12:28 UTC
rarity
common
prev
next